Section 13. Disposal considerations
Disposal methods :
The generation of waste should be avoided or minimized wherever
possible. Disposal of this product, solutions and any by-products
should at all times comply with the requirements of environmental
protection and waste disposal legislation and any regional local
authority requirements. Dispose of surplus and non-recyclable
products via a licensed waste disposal contractor. Waste should not be
disposed of untreated to the sewer unless fully compliant with the
requirements of all authorities with jurisdiction. Waste packaging
should be recycled. Incineration or landfill should only be considered
when recycling is not feasible. This material and its container must be
disposed of in a safe way. Care should be taken when handling
emptied containers that have not been cleaned or rinsed out. Empty
containers or liners may retain some product residues. Avoid dispersal
of spilled material and runoff and contact with soil, waterways, drains
and sewers.
